Tanuki Doubles Up on Indigo and Piles on the Slub

In Japan, the tanuki is a mythical symbol of good luck, and lucky is exactly what you’ll be if you can slip into these Tanuki IDHT “Double Indigo” 15oz. selvedge denim jeans- especially if you can achieve the bright electric blue fades that this slubby denim has the potential for.

They’re set up for successful fades of mythical proportions with a generously slubby all-cotton denim made of a twice rope-dyed indigo warp and weft. It’s also equipped with antique gold branded buttons, riveted back pockets, brown herringbone pocket bags, a vegetable-tanned leather patch that echoes the back pocket stitching detail, and pink and white selvedge with a bright blue interior inseam thread.
